What is Active Investment Management (AIM)?
 
Optimising return from investment in projects by

-   managing the variables that put at risk the return
-   increasing discipline, transparency and auditability of project investment decision making

To allow you to implement the AIM disciplines into your business we have developed the AIM methodologies:

AIM Project Driving business outcomes from investment in projects
AIM Portfolio Balancing project portfolios to optimise business outcomes within affordability constraints
AIM Transition Ensuring business operational readiness by proving completeness of process and system transition
AIM Operation Continually improving operational performance
